A typical inpatient program runs anywhere from 30 days to 6 months. During detox, click now doctors and dependency professionals monitor patients' important indications while the compounds exit the system.

During inpatient therapy, clients have accessibility to 24-hour clinical interest. Outpatient therapy is generally taken into consideration to be less limiting than inpatient programs.

Most residential programs have a PHP that people generally change to if they live locally. PHP programs are usually 5-6 hours of therapy each day, usually for 5-6 days a week. This degree of care is typically done while not working, as the therapy itself can be as time consuming as household treatment.
This allows even more flexibility for job and life needs, as well as a possibility to adjust into the globe with support. These sessions concentrate on regression avoidance, psychoeducation, private, and group counseling; teaching recovery skills to aid minimize relapse and advertise long term healing - Drug-Free Life. Outpatient therapy can be a practical option for somebody with a mild compound usage disorder, or it can be part of a lasting treatment program
Individuals with click to find out more mild to modest substance withdrawal symptoms could find outpatient cleansing a suitable alternative to household detoxification. Outpatient detox is safe, effective, and can be more versatile for those that are regarded ready by a treatment expert. Unlike residential detox, individuals have to see a health center or other treatment center for physical and psychological check-ups during outpatient detoxification.
